Ceiling Fan Motors…What makes a Difference?

The heart of every ceiling fan is the motor. The motor is responsible for producing quiet operation while driving the blades for air movement. Look for high-quality motors with heavy-duty windings and sealed bearings that are permanently lubricated. Smaller, less powerful motors found on lower quality fans may produce higher operating temperatures, …

Selecting Exterior Lighting

Selecting the right sized outdoor lanterns for your home sometimes poses a challenge.  Here are some tips for a fit that’s just right: If you have one light next to your front door:  it should measure about 1/3 the height of the door. the center of the bulb should be about 66” above the threshold of the door. If you have two lights on either …
